Was the pastel male you bred her to completely unrelated to her? He would have been carrying the same recesssive gene for the trait as she was! The odds are stacked way against that. Were they at least kissing cousins? LOL  In other words what I am asking is if the pastel male was related to her in some way and you were using her to pass on some nice trait to your pastel line? Would you post a picture of her? I guess that is why I like normals. They could carry a very nice recessive gene and no one would know it till they get paired up with the right partner.
